When we feel supported in the workplace and at home, there’s nothing we can’t achieve in the cloud.The Brick and Network Deployment (BaND) team ensures data center network and port capacity is available for incoming customer racks (demand). Customer racks (also known as server racks) need this capacity (networking racks) to gain access to the AWS network to provide service capacity for AWS customers.
